Important information:

  • Up to 2 children 11 years old and younger stay free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.
  • The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). Addit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.

Not up to Okura standards for F&B, way overpriced
Pros:

This is a decent hotel overall - clean well furnished bedrooms with all the facilities that you might require - if seriously expensive. Downside really amounts to F&B. This offering is woefully below what one would expect. To eat dinner in the hotel restaurant requires three days notice and a minimum of ¥ 22,000 per person (USD150). There is a lounge menu but this is hard to access - essentially the hotel offered only coffee and free wine between 3 and 6 pm (sparkling wine came from a barrel!) A glass of wine on the lounge menu if you can find it before 9pm is around ¥4,000. Breakfast is too expensive - ¥6,500 for a continental breakfast delivered in single portions - you keep having to ask for the second croissant or pain au chocolat! Compare this to ¥5,000 for a great room service delivered breakfast at the Mandarin Oriental in Tokyo and you can see the level of overprice. The Okura in Tokyo also offers better value!. The hotel is around 30 mins walk from downtown so a ¥1,000 to ¥2,000 taxi each way. So perhaps if you want Okura style at a sensible price, try the Okura in town instead.
